The rapid growth of avocado production in Mexico has intensified concerns about balancing economic competitiveness with environmental sustainability, especially regarding water use and production intensification. This study introduces the Integrated Competitiveness and Sustainability Composite Index for Avocado (ICSCA), a multidimensional indicator that evaluates the structural performance of avocado production systems across Mexican states. The index combines environmental efficiency, economic productivity, and socio-productive stability, using state level data from 2014–2024. The ICSCA was calculated and examined through principal component analysis, regression models, and spatial visualization. Results show strong heterogeneity among producing regions. States like Michoacan and Jalisco achieve high productivity and economic output but exert significant pressure on water resources, while others maintain more balanced sustainability profiles with moderate productivity; furthermore, spatial patterns reveal clear regional gradients in sustainability performance. Robust tests, including out of sample temporal validation, expanding window validation, and sliding window analysis, demonstrate high predictive consistency across analysis periods. Overall, the ICSCA provides a robust tool for assessing the interactions between productivity, environmental efficiency, and social structural stability, supporting evidence-based policy design and regional planning for more sustainable avocado production.
